Jupiter, Venus, Mercury and the Moon rule the classically benefic hours; the Sun, Mars, Saturn hours are treated as malefic for new undertakings. See also the Kolkata Choghaḍiyā and the full Kolkata panchāṅga for 18 February 2027.

How this table was computed

Method12 day hours (sunrise→sunset) and 12 night hours (sunset→next sunrise), unequal by season; the sequence runs in the Chaldean order starting from the weekday lord's hour (classical derivation); sunrise/sunset from Swiss Ephemeris
